Brenda Schultz-Mccarthy won the 1995 Oklahoma, defeating Elena Likhovtseva 6-1 6-2 in the final. The WTA 250 event was played on hard courts in Oklahoma, United States, from February 13 to February 19, 1995.

Frequently Asked Questions

Where is Oklahoma held?
Oklahoma is held in Oklahoma, United States.
Who won the most recent Oklahoma?
The 1999 Oklahoma was won by Venus Williams 6-4 6-0.
Who has won the most Oklahoma titles?
Brenda Schultz-Mccarthy has won 2 Oklahoma titles, the most by any player.
When was the first Oklahoma played?
The first edition of Oklahoma was held in 1986.
What surface is Oklahoma played on?
Oklahoma is played on hard courts.
